Publication number: 20250143070Abstract: The present application discloses a display panel and a display device. The display panel includes at least two light-emitting layers stacked in a thickness direction of the display panel. A charge generation layer is provided between two adjacent light-emitting layers, and includes a first charge generation part and a second charge generation part. In a direction perpendicular to the thickness direction of the display panel, each light-emitting layer includes a first light-emitting part and a second light-emitting part spaced apart from each other. In the thickness direction of the display panel, an orthographic projection of the first charge generation part on the light-emitting layer covers the first light-emitting part, an orthographic projection of the second charge generation part on the light-emitting layer covers the second light-emitting part, and the first charge generation part has a thickness greater than a thickness of the second charge generation part.Type: ApplicationFiled: January 3, 2025Publication date: May 1, 2025Applicant: KUNSHAN GO-VISIONOX OPTO-ELECTRONICS CO., LTD.Inventor: Zhimin YAN

QUANTUM DOT LUMINESCENT MATERIAL, QUANTUM DOT PATTERNING METHOD, QUANTUM DOT FILM AND DISPLAY DEVICE
Publication number: 20250040422Abstract: A quantum dot luminescent material, a quantum dot patterning method, a quantum dot film, and a display device. The quantum dot luminescent material includes a plurality of quantum dots; a plurality of ligands attached to the quantum dots; a plurality of crosslinking reactants configured to undergo a crosslinking reaction to connect at least two of the quantum dots and the crosslinking reactants being a plurality of crosslinking molecules or a plurality of crosslinking groups; wherein the quantum dots and the crosslinking reactants satisfy at least one of Condition (1), Condition (2), or a combination thereof: Condition (1): the crosslinking reactants have a lowest unoccupied molecular orbital (LUMO) energy level that is located outside a bandgap of the quantum dots; and Condition (2): the crosslinking reactants have a highest occupied molecular orbital (HOMO) energy level that is located outside the bandgap of the quantum dots.Type: ApplicationFiled: October 16, 2024Publication date: January 30, 2025Applicant: Yungu (Gu’an) Technology Co., Ltd.Inventors: Fuxing JIAO, Zhimin YAN, Liang SU, Fengjie JIN -

Publication number: 20240277923Abstract: An ambulatory pump having a disposable drug container comprised of a flexible IV-type bag sealed to a length of tubing extending from the IV bag. The IV bag is contained in a lightweight rigid housing facilitating attachment to the skin and providing a guide channel for the IV tube against a retaining wall. This allows a motorized backpack to be simply installed on the rigid housing of the drug container for peristaltic pumping of the medicine through the IV tube during use, and then removed from the drug container for reuse with a different drug container, minimizing the overall system cost.Type: ApplicationFiled: February 16, 2024Publication date: August 22, 2024Inventors: Chao Young Lee, Zhenhua Mao, James Zhimin Yan, Mei Zhang

Patent number: 10417389Abstract: An application authoring tool and application program system for medical pumps provides each pump with a standardized hardware interface abstracting the hardware and tasks done by the pump in order to provide a uniform interface for application programmers across different pump types. The standardized interface may translate hardware communication with hardware on different machines, do hardware signal range checking, and handle routine but detailed hardware tasks such as error reporting. A system for installing multiple applications on pumps allows a flexible trade-off between reducing pump programming time by loading specialized application programs and preserving pump flexibility by allowing the user to select among multiple applications.Type: GrantFiled: December 4, 2015Date of Patent: September 17, 2019Assignee: Zyno Medical, LLCInventors: Chao Young Lee, Mei Zhang, James Zhimin Yan

Patent number: 8945043Abstract: A medical device, such as an infusion pump, obtains a contextual awareness of its operation by communicating with centralized patient records and or other medical equipment communicating with a common patient, and/or provides real time advisory information, at care point or remotely. A protocol obtained by the medical device from a protocol server provides context-aware protocols and necessary predicate information for those protocols. This predicate information may be discovered by the medical device communicating with electronic medical records and the associated medical equipment.Type: GrantFiled: November 28, 2012Date of Patent: February 3, 2015Assignee: Zyno Medical, LLC.Inventors: Chaoyoung Lee, James Zhimin Yan, Mei Zhang
